Anyone who has attended a trade show or convention knows how draining constant networking can be. Taking a few minutes to recharge can restore your energy and make the rest of the event more enjoyable.

The Boston Convention & Exhibition Center is responding to that need by creating an on-site space dedicated to relaxation and recreation — a playground for adults.

Called The Lawn on D, this experimental event space is designed to invite public interaction, spark creativity and explore ways to better integrate the convention center with the surrounding neighborhood.

Featuring arts, music, games, food and community-driven programming, The Lawn on D opens on Aug. 16 for an 18-month trial period. During that time, the Massachusetts Convention Center Authority will test a variety of programs and activities to help inform plans for a permanent outdoor area that will be part of the BCEC expansion.

Open daily, the 2.7-acre outdoor space on D Street at the BCEC offers multiple options for relaxation and recreation. Visitors will find public seating and lounge chairs, rotating public art installations, a selection of games including bocce and ping-pong, and free Wi-Fi. Local food trucks provide refreshments, and a 5,000-square-foot tent with a permanent bar makes the Lawn suitable for private events as well.
